  • Why are plasticizers added to ca?
  • Plasticizers are added to CA to increase workability, prevent degradation under processing conditions and ensure thermo-mechanical properties suitable for the intended final application. Moreover, inexpensive and non-toxic solvents enable its processing into fibers, films, and solid blocks.
  • How is plasticization established?
  • Plasticization is established when the plasticizer molecules are able to disturb the pronounced interaction in a polymeric matrix by acting as a lubricant, and therefore enhancing the gliding effect.

  • How does plasticization work?
  • Plasticization is most commonly accounted for using free volume theory [39,43, 53]. In general, plasticization theories concur that plasticizers, which are small molecules with low T g s, act by penetrating into the polymer, producing a separation of the polymer chains and reducing the intermolecular forces between the polymer chains . ... ...
